Abstract:
This paper elaborates the concept of the renewable district heating system (DHS) in Municipality of Visoko, Bosnia and Herzegovina, as part of the CoolHeating project funded by the EU’s Horizon 2020 programme, which is going to be integrated into the planned DHS supplied by a combined heat and power facility (CHP).
